    Do your VX, HX and TX series work perfectly with Abit's IP35 Pro XE?

    I would like to know this before buying. It stands between you and Seasonic's S12 Energy Plus series.

    If mounted in a P182, will the cables be long enough? (I was thinking of the 12-pin motherboard cable in particular.)

    Thanks!

    ~ Kris

    Re: Do your VX, HX and TX series work perfectly with Abit's IP35 Pro XE?

    12 pin cable?
    surely you mean the 24 pin main ATX power....
    or possibly the 8/4 pin CPU power cable....

    and if it is an atx motherboard then it will take an atx powersupply.... (which is what the ones you have stated are)

    and there are quite a few people using the corsar HX series in the p182 succesfully

    but i can say catagorically... YES, yes it will work...

    Re: Do your VX, HX and TX series work perfectly with Abit's IP35 Pro XE?

    I've had problems with ATX PSUs combined with ATX motherboards before. Bugs do happen as do incompatibilities unfortunately. Just want to make sure this is not the case with your PSUs and Abit's IP35 Pro XE board before placing any orders. (My current Seasonic S12 600W has terrible cold boot issues with an old DFI nF4 LP board of mine, the DFI works fine with other PSU's however.)

    I meant to say 12v 8 pin cable btw. It's a bit late and I'm tired and sloppy, my apologies. Regarding the cable length, here's a picture:
    Picture

    It's quite a far stretch considering the PSU's position at the bottom of the P182 case. If I have to use an extension cable to get it to work, will it work without any problems or should using extensions be avoided at all costs (increased resistance, etc, I'm not that into electrics though)? Do all the VX, HX and TX models feature the same cable lengths?

    Re: Do your VX, HX and TX series work perfectly with Abit's IP35 Pro XE?

    Our cable lengths in general are designed to be long enough for full tower cases and work fine with the P180, 182, etc. All our PSUs work fine with the ABIT IP35 series MOBOs.
